Senior Portraits

The Saturday, October 19, deadline for submitting senior portraits is approaching.  When submitting your senior portraits for the yearbook, please note that our submission hub, eShare, automatically adjusts the senior portraits to the correct size for publication.

Choose a high-quality senior portrait that follows the following requirements:
  • Portraits only, no full or half body shots.
  • 300 dpi/ppi resolution -This is the most important part to get correct. This is a full resolution for print images. Cell phone photos and photos from the web are too small to reproduce in the yearbook.
  • Color photos only.
  • Plain/neutral background required.
  • Full face view, facing forward.
  • Clothing and jewelry must fit school dress code guidelines.
  • No creative filters or photographic treatments.
  • No props (this includes animals and cars) or hand signs of any kind.
  • No tattoos or hats.
Only crop the photo to your liking in the eShare submission. If you like the photograph as is, fully extend the cropping tool in eShare so it doesn't cut out parts of the portrait that you want.

If your/your child's senior portrait has been approved, you will receive an email with confirmation. If your/your child's senior portrait is not approved, you will receive an email letting you know the reason and how you should proceed. Please be patient as this communication may take a few business days.

Senior Baby Ads

Questions can be directed to rosella.boyer@sno.wednet.edu.


Applaud your child’s achievements with a tribute in their yearbook. Celebrate with words of congratulation, praise & encouragement. This year we are trying something new and allowing parents and/or guardians to create and design their senior’s baby ad through our publishing company, Varsity Yearbooks.

Helpful Tips and Tricks:
  • We do not check spelling. Double check that you have spelled everything correctly (names, quotes, etc).
  • Find pictures that are meaningful to you and your family.
  • Avoid including baby photos containing nudity, we cannot publish these.
  • Avoid pictures of boyfriends/girlfriends as we cannot go back and edit the baby ad once it has been submitted.
  • This is your time to tell the student how proud you are of them, reminisce, and look forward to their future. Do not be afraid to express yourself.
  • Make sure that the message to your senior if appropriate. If there are inappropriate words or phrases the yearbook staff will edit the message so it is appropriate to print. This will be done without any notice.
